Fixed price advice:
Better scare someone off with in the beginning than p*** someone off
in the middle of the road, because you had made a wrong estimate.
No surprise for your customer is still the best way of keeping him.
Don't be wishy-washy.
Hourly price advice:
You shouldn't do that, if you still learn yourself. Don't underestimate
your customers, they can tell easily. Don't do that, if your customer
sort of doesn't know _exactly_ what he wants. Otherwise it might be
better for you to work by the hour to protect yourself...
"I don't do databases" advice:
That's why you can sell your services with IC, you don't necessarily
need to do databases...
